Yo! I've been in your shoes with the header thing.... I have a used collected RB header for my '88 SE. I upgraded to the full RoadRace system last year. My old collected header is stashed in my attic & in decent shape. PM me if you are interested. I had bought a "catalyzer" piece that connected to the y-pipe from the header that had the air tube for the 5th & 6th port actuators. I through that thing away though... Just a warning - it really sounded terrible....like a swarm of angry bees. The full RoadRace sounds awesome & quiet as well. I would try & save up the bucks for the full system.
